Conclusion
• In the year 2008 60% of the visitors people came for the first time to see
  what Alternative Party is all about. In the year 2011 only 30% were first
  timers.
• In 2008 people had several reasons to come and the people did not present
  a single group, but many different interests.
• Average age grew in the year 2011 more than before.
• The growing amount of female visitors dropped in 2011.
• The year 2011 included mostly old visitors who came to see their friends.
• Social media was the most efficient marketing channel in the year 2011.
• The big changes in the year 2011 were due the event was only marketed in
  social media and through friends. Also the theme interested older people
  who remember the soviet times.

• And: DEMOS & COMPOS HAVE ALWAYS BEEN AMONG THE MAIN REASONS
  FOR COMING TO ALTERNATIVE PARTY!
